Blooming Onion with Dhal - James Martin Chef
The best way to describe this is an onion flower! Blooming Onion with Dhal served with yoghurt, coriander, mint leaves, garlic & lemon dip!
Ingredients
- 80g butter
- 1 onion, diced
- 5-cm piece fresh ginger, chopped
- 3 garlic cloves, chopped
- 1 red chilli, diced
- 2 tsp black mustard seeds
- 1½ tsp turmeric
- 2 tsp ground coriander
- 2 tsp garam masala
- 250g red lentils
- handful of coriander, chopped
- 1 lemon, juiced
- 2 large onions, peeled
- 100ml milk
- 100g plain flour
- Vegetable oil, for frying
- 100g thick Greek yoghurt
- 1 small bunch of coriander
- a few mint leaves
- 1 garlic clove
- 1 lemon, juice only
- For the dhal, melt half the butter in a large saucepan over a medium to high heat. Add the chopped onion and fry, stirring regularly, for about 10 mins, or until soft and golden.
- Stir in the ginger, garlic and chilli, and fry for another minute, then add the mustard seeds, turmeric, coriander and garam masala. Season well and cook the spices for 1-2 min
- Add the red lentils and 750ml water, then reduce the heat to a simmer and cook the lentils for 30 mins until tender. You may have to add a little more water, depending on how large your pan is.
- Finish with herbs and lemon juice.
- Blitz all the ingredients together for the dip.
- To serve, spoon the dhal onto plates, top with an onion and add a spoonful of dip.
